Luke 23:47-49
New American Standard Bible
47 (A)Now when the centurion saw what had happened, he began (B)praising God, saying, “This man was in fact [a]innocent.” 48 And all the crowds who came together for this spectacle, after watching what had happened, began to return home, [b](C)beating their chests. 49 (D)And all His acquaintances and (E)the women who accompanied Him from Galilee were standing at a distance, seeing these things.
